AutoZone was established in 1987 by J.R. Hyde as an aftermarket automotive parts retailing chain. Hyde focused on offering affordable prices and high quality customer service, a set of business principles that are still the core of AutoZone's business strategy to the present day. Hyde developed his business through acquisitions. He bought the Auto Palace and Chief Auto Parts chain.
The first store under the AutoZone name was opened on July 4, 1989, in Hobbs, New Mexico, and was called simply "AutoZone." The company continued to expand quickly throughout the 1990s. In 1994, AutoZone was selling its products through a network of more than 1,000 stores. To keep up with the growth, AutoZone implemented Flexogram the automated system designed to tailor inventory according to local demands and improve communication between stores.
Autozone's headquarters are in Memphis, Tennessee. It manages operations in the United States as well as in South America. The E-Commerce Fulfillment Center, located in Memphis, is used to process and ship Vendor Direct Parts (VDP) from stores to customers who make online orders. The Z-net website of the company features details on repairs made with a single click, product images, specifications and troubleshooting.

Silca
The Silca Futura Auto is an electronic key machine which can cut automotive keys or duplicate them with amazing precision. It comes with a cutting station, two interchangeable clamps as well as an inbuilt database of keys for cars. The database holds information about any other keys that are used in vehicles, such as roof racks and glove boxes. The Futura Auto is also easy to use due to its touchscreen.
This key duplicator can duplicate most flat cylinder keys, including cruciform and large bow keys. Its compact size and weight make it a great machine for jobs on the move. It can duplicate 300 brass keys or 180 steel keys with one charge. The battery will last for about two days. It also has a slide-in safety shield and a quality PCB that monitors the battery's status.
Silca's Futura Pro One can originate or duplicate laser, dimple, Tibbe, and tubular keys. It comes with a 10-inch tablet that is used to operate the machine. It is highly reliable of precision and is able to operate in extreme conditions. It also scans the key to determine its cuts, which can save time and money. It is simple to use and maintain.
